The Legend of Ossian: A Historical Overview

The Origins of Ossian

The name Ossian evokes images of ancient Celtic landscapes, of misty hills and turbulent seas, and of a bard whose verses spoke of heroes and epic battles. Traditionally attributed to the mythological poet Ossian, these tales were reimagined and compiled by James Macpherson in the 18th century. Macpherson's work, titled "The Poems of Ossian," blended authenticity with literary creativity, leading some to call his output a form of forgery. Nonetheless, the collection inspired a surge of romanticism that permeated arts and literature well into the 19th century.

William Wordsworth and the Romantic Influence

One famous admirer was William Wordsworth, whose evocative poetry in "Glen Almain; or, the Narrow Glen" encapsulates the beauty of nature as well as the profound tranquility that can be found away from the chaos of daily life. In it, Wordsworth contemplates the serene yet tumultuous spirit of Ossian, reflecting a deep connection with both the natural world and the timeless stories of heroism that defined Celtic culture. Oriza L. Legrand: A Fragrance House Revival

An Historical Legacy

Founded in 1905, Oriza L. Legrand was one of the original perfume houses, distinguished for its artisanal approach to fragrance creation. During a time when such houses were markers of luxury and tradition, Oriza L. Legrand stood out by marrying the elegance of craftsmanship with the artistic influences of historical figures and stories. This innovative blend gave rise to some of the most compelling fragrances of its era.

The Resurgence of Tradition in Modern Perfume

Fast forward to 2012, and Oriza L. Legrand was reborn in the contemporary perfume scene. While the brand paid homage to its storied past, it also embraced modern sensibilities in its formulations. The relaunch reinvigorated interest in the brand, drawing attention to its hidden gems like Rêve d'Ossian, which seamlessly integrates historical elements with present-day olfactory experiences.

Rêve d'Ossian: A Fragrant Interpretation

The Olfactory Composition

Rêve d'Ossian is an intriguing fragrance that balances fresh and evergreen notes with hints of incense and spice. Upon initial application, one is welcomed by the invigorating scents of coniferous trees, reminiscent of a brisk winter morning in an ancient forest. This opening is artistry at its finest—an olfactory bridge to the past. As the scent evolves, it reveals layers of warmth and spice, intermingling with the coolness of its earthy base. The incense notes reference a spiritual essence, echoing the rituals of wood sprites and wise men who revered both nature and the divine. In a way, Rêve d'Ossian offers a modern interpretation of an ancient narrative, capturing the essence of nostalgia while remaining undeniably contemporary.
